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
88492 92724 273262 420154243
3850932168 702528 5595791
3850932168 702528 5595791
7726 844448 5308631808
All about undefined
Interested in learning more?
3850932168 702528 5595791
7726 844448 5308631808
See more
253815674 47 71460
80372 32 650006 8444
See more
3095415 6367358475
3892 5675230984 966 9450506 50722920
See more